Pakistan Day reception hails strength of UAE partnership

In a vibrant celebration of Pakistan’s National Day, the Embassy of Pakistan in Abu Dhabi hosted a reception attended by UAE Government officials, diplomats, and the Pakistani community.
The event, attended by Shaikh Nahayan bin Mabarak Al Nahayan, Minister of Tolerance and Coexistence; and Ahmad Bin Ali Al Sayegh, Minister of State for Foreign Affairs, underscored the strength of the UAE-Pakistan partnership.
Pakistan Day falls on March 23, but the official reception was held on April 8 in Abu Dhabi.
Pakistan Day reflects on the historical importance of the Pakistan Resolution, which laid the foundation for the creation of Pakistan in 1947.
